URL Structure Optimization for SEO
A well-optimized URL helps both Google and users understand what your page is about. A clean URL makes your site easier to crawl, improves ranking signals, and increases click-through rates because users can instantly see the topic from the link itself. A messy or confusing URL can make Google misunderstand your content or split ranking power across multiple versions of the same page. That’s why URL structure optimization is an important part of on-page SEO.
Why URL Structure Matters for SEO
A good URL helps your page in three simple ways:
- Improves clarity → Google can easily identify the topic
- Boosts click-through rates → users trust clean, readable URLs
- Supports indexing → makes crawling faster and easier
For example, a short and clear URL performs much better than a long and confusing one.
How to Optimise URL Structure for SEO (Step-by-Step)
1. Keep URLs Short, Clean, and Simple
Short URLs are easier for Google to understand and easier for users to read.
Good Example:
https://example.com/seo-tips
Bad Example:
https://example.com/2025/01/17/how-to-optimise-your-seo-tips-for-google-ranking/
Short URLs improve readability and ranking potential.
2. Use Your Primary Keyword in the URL
Place your main keyword naturally inside the URL. Do not overstuff or repeat the keyword.
Example:
Title: “How to Do Keyword Research”
URL:
https://example.com/keyword-research
This tells Google exactly what the page is about.
3. Use Hyphens (–), Not Underscores (_)
Google prefers hyphens because they separate words clearly.
Correct:
/on-page-seo-checklist
Incorrect:
/on_page_seo_checklist
4. Avoid Stop Words (and, of, the, for, to)
Stop words make URLs unnecessarily long.
Better:
/what-is-canonical-tag
Not:
/what-is-a-canonical-tag-and-how-to-use-it
5. Use Lowercase Letters Only
Uppercase letters can create duplicate URL issues.
Correct:
/image-optimisation-seo
Wrong:
/Image-Optimisation-SEO
6. Avoid Numbers, Dates, and Years in URLs
Numbers lock your content. If you update the page, the URL becomes outdated.
Example:
/seo-tools (Good)
/seo-tools-2024 (Risky → needs updating every year)
7. Make URLs Future-Proof
Keep the structure simple and scalable, especially for large websites.
Example for blogs:
/blog/keyword-research-guide
Example for products:
/products/wireless-headphones

Common URL Mistakes to Avoid
- Using extremely long URLs
- Adding too many folders or subfolders
- Keyword stuffing
- Using special characters (%,&,$,@)
- Changing URLs frequently without redirects
